How to Create a Crypto Exchange Platform Like Binance?

Cryptocurrency exchanges have become a popular way for people to trade and invest in digital currencies. These platforms provide users with a secure and convenient way to buy, sell, and store different cryptocurrencies. One of the most successful and well-known cryptocurrency exchanges is Binance. Launched in 2017, Binance has quickly become the largest exchange in terms of trading volume. In this guide, we will discuss the essential steps you need to take to create your own crypto exchange platform like Binance.

Why Create a Crypto Exchange Like Binance?

Before diving into the steps to create a crypto exchange platform, it is essential to understand why it is worth investing time and resources into building an exchange like Binance. One of the main reasons is the increasing popularity and adoption of cryptocurrencies. As more people become interested in digital currencies, there will be a growing demand for trading platforms. This surge in interest is fueled by the desire for decentralized financial systems, privacy, and the potential for high returns on investment. Additionally, creating your own crypto exchange can also generate significant revenue through transaction fees, listing fees for new cryptocurrencies, and premium features for advanced trading options. By tapping into this burgeoning market, entrepreneurs can position themselves at the forefront of financial innovation and technology.

Also Read: Creating Your Own Crypto Trading Bot

Steps to create a Crypto Exchange Platform like Binance

Step 1:- Discovery Phase and Market Research

Before embarking on creating a crypto exchange platform, it is essential to conduct thorough market research and identify your target audience. Understanding the demographics, preferences, and pain points of your potential users will provide invaluable insights. This step will help you determine the features and functionalities your platform needs to have to attract users, such as security measures, user-friendly interfaces, and a variety of trading options.

Additionally, it would be beneficial to study the strategies of existing exchanges like Binance and understand what makes them successful in the market. Analyzing their marketing tactics, fee structures, and customer support can offer guidance on best practices. Furthermore, keeping abreast of regulatory requirements and technological advancements will ensure that your platform remains compliant and competitive. By laying a solid foundation through comprehensive research and strategic planning, you can increase the chances of launching a successful crypto exchange platform.

Step 2:- Determine the Operational Region and Legal Structure

Crypto regulations vary from country to country, and it is crucial to identify the region in which you want your platform to operate. Choosing a location with favorable crypto laws and a vibrant market can be advantageous for your exchange’s growth. Additionally, deciding on the legal structure of your business entity will determine factors like liability, taxation, and fundraising options. Consulting with legal experts familiar with cryptocurrency laws can help you make informed decisions.

Step 3: Hire a legal team of counselors, advisors, and auditors

As the crypto market is evolving rapidly, navigating legal complexities can be challenging. Hence, it is crucial to have a team of legal experts who can guide you through the process and ensure compliance with laws and regulations. This team should consist of experienced professionals who understand the intricacies of the crypto landscape and can offer comprehensive support.

Counselors can offer advice on operational matters like drafting and reviewing user agreements, privacy policies, and terms of service to ensure they meet legal standards and protect your interests. They can also help navigate jurisdiction-specific regulations and provide insights on intellectual property rights, ensuring that your innovations and brand are well-protected.

Advisors can provide insights on various fundraising options, including Initial Coin Offerings (ICOs), Security Token Offerings (STOs), and venture capital, helping you choose the best path for your project’s growth. They can also assist with financial planning, creating strategies for long-term success, risk management, identifying potential pitfalls, and developing contingency plans.

Auditors can assist in monitoring your platform’s security measures, conducting thorough assessments to detect potential vulnerabilities, and ensuring that your system is resilient against cyber threats. They can also help with regulatory audits, preparing your company for compliance checks, and maintaining transparency with stakeholders.

Step 4:- Choose the Type of cryptocurrency exchange

When it comes to setting up your cryptocurrency exchange, there are a few different types to choose from. Each has its unique features and benefits, so it is essential to understand the differences before making your decision.

  • Centralized Exchange: This type of exchange is controlled by a central authority, which manages all transactions and holds users’ funds. These exchanges typically have low fees and high liquidity but can be prone to hacking or government regulation.
  • Decentralized Exchange (DEX): DEXs operate on blockchain technology without any central authority controlling transactions or holding user funds. They offer higher security and privacy due to their decentralized nature but may have lower liquidity and higher fees.
  • Hybrid Exchange: A hybrid exchange combines the features of both centralized and decentralized exchanges, offering users a mix of security, privacy, and liquidity options.

Step 5:- Budget Calculation

Before setting up your cryptocurrency exchange, it is crucial to create a budget that takes into account all necessary expenses. Some of the key costs to consider include:

  • Legal and regulatory fees: Depending on your jurisdiction, you may need to obtain licenses or comply with regulations for operating a cryptocurrency exchange.
  • Technological infrastructure: This includes developing or purchasing the software platform, securing servers and hosting services, and implementing security measures.
  • Marketing and advertising: It is essential to promote your exchange to attract users, so budgeting for marketing expenses is vital.
  • Operational costs: These can include salaries for employees, rent for office space, and other operational expenses.

Step 6:- Design the Architecture of the Exchange

The next step is to design the architecture of your cryptocurrency exchange. This includes deciding on the user interface, trading features, and security measures. Some key factors to consider include:

  • User interface: The user interface should be intuitive and easy to navigate for a seamless trading experience.
  • Trading features: Decide which types of orders you want to offer (e.g., market, limit, stop-loss) and any additional features such as margin trading or lending.
  • Security measures: Implementing robust security measures is crucial for protecting your users’ funds and data. Consider implementing two-factor authentication, encryption, and other security protocols.

Step 7:- Create And Verify UX/UI Design

Once you have the architecture in place, it is time to create and verify the user experience (UX) and user interface (UI) design. This involves designing wireframes and mockups to get a visual representation of how your exchange will look and function. Wireframes are basic, low-fidelity sketches that outline the layout and interaction points of your platform, while mockups are more detailed and high-fidelity representations that incorporate design elements such as colors, typography, and branding.

It is important to involve potential users or focus groups in this process to gather feedback on the design and make necessary improvements. Conducting usability tests and interviews can provide valuable insights into how real users interact with your platform and identify any pain points or areas for enhancement. This iterative process of testing and refining can help ensure that your exchange meets user expectations and provides a positive trading experience. Ultimately, a well-designed UX/UI can enhance user satisfaction, increase engagement, and drive the success of your platform.

Step 8:- Build from Base Or Pick An Off-the-shelf Solution

Once you have a clear vision, architecture, and design for your exchange, you can start building. You have two options – build from scratch or choose an off-the-shelf solution.

Building from scratch gives you complete control over the development process and allows for customizations to fit your specific needs. However, it requires a significant investment of time and resources as you will need to build every aspect of your platform from the ground up.

On the other hand, picking an off-the-shelf solution can save time and effort as the basic infrastructure is already in place. Many companies offer white-label solutions that allow you to launch a fully functional exchange with minimal development effort. However, this option may limit your ability to customize and differentiate your platform from others in the market.

Step 9:-Partnership with the leading payment processor

One of the key elements of a successful cryptocurrency exchange is the ability to facilitate seamless and secure transactions for users. This requires integration with a reliable payment processor that supports multiple currencies and payment methods.

Partnering with a leading payment processor can help you provide users with a wide range of options for buying, selling, and storing cryptocurrencies on your platform. It also helps build trust among users, as they know their funds are in safe hands.

Step 10:- Ensure to have strong features and security measures

To attract and retain users, your exchange should offer a robust set of features that make trading easy, convenient, and secure. These include:

  • Intuitive user interface: A simple and user-friendly interface makes it easier for beginners to navigate the platform.
  • Multi-currency support: Your exchange should support major cryptocurrencies such as Bitcoin, Ethereum, Litecoin, etc., as well as fiat currencies.
  • Advanced order types: Different traders have different strategies; hence your platform should support advanced order types such as stop-loss orders, limit orders, etc.
  • High liquidity: Liquidity is crucial for an exchange’s success. Partnering with liquidity providers can help ensure a consistent supply of buyers and sellers on your platform.
  • Two-factor authentication: Implementing two-factor authentication adds an extra layer of security to user accounts, making it harder for hackers to gain unauthorized access.
  • Cold storage: Storing the majority of user funds in offline or cold wallets helps protect them from online attacks.

Step 11:- Testing and Launch

Before launching your exchange, it is crucial to thoroughly test all aspects of the platform. This includes testing for bugs, and security vulnerabilities, and ensuring that all features are functioning correctly.

It is also important to have a beta testing period where a limited number of users can access the platform and provide feedback. This allows you to make necessary improvements before the official launch.

Once all issues have been addressed and the platform is stable, it can be officially launched to the public. It is important to continuously monitor and maintain the exchange for any potential issues or updates.

Step 12: Deployment and Marketing

After the launch, it is important to focus on marketing your exchange to attract users. This can include creating informative content, social media marketing, and collaborations with other companies in the cryptocurrency space.

It is also essential to have a user-friendly interface and provide excellent customer support to retain users and attract new ones.

Read More: Discovering Where to Hire Blockchain Developers

Go For Our Best Binance Clone Script!

If you are looking to build your own cryptocurrency exchange platform, using a Binance clone script can save you time and resources. Our Binance clone script is a ready-made solution that includes all the necessary features and security protocols of the original Binance exchange.

With our Binan0ce clone script, you can customize the design and branding of your exchange while having access to advanced trading features such as margin trading and spot trading.

Partnering with liquidity providers can help ensure a consistent supply of buyers and sellers on your platform, allowing for smooth trading experiences for users.

A Message from iTechnolabs

We at iTechnolabs understand the challenges and complexities of building a cryptocurrency exchange. Our team of experts is dedicated to providing top-notch solutions for your exchange development needs.

With our experience in blockchain technology, we can help you create a secure and user-friendly platform that will attract and retain users. Contact us today to learn more about our services and how we can help bring your exchange idea to life!  So, if you are ready to take the leap into the ever-evolving world of cryptocurrency exchanges, let iTechnolabs be your guide.

How Much Does It Cost to Build a Crypto Exchange Platform Like Binance?

The cost of building a cryptocurrency exchange platform like Binance can vary significantly based on several factors. These factors include the features you wish to include, such as advanced trading options, user-friendly interfaces, and comprehensive analytics tools. Additionally, the level of security protocols is crucial, as a higher level of encryption and multi-factor authentication will increase costs but ensure better protection for users. Moreover, the geographical location of your development team plays a role, as hiring skilled developers in regions with higher living costs can be more expensive than in other areas. Other considerations might include ongoing maintenance, legal compliance, and customer support infrastructure, which can all impact the final budget.

  • Basic Features: A basic cryptocurrency exchange with essential trading features such as buy/sell orders, market data, and user account management could cost between $50,000 to $80,000. This price range usually covers standard functionalities necessary to get the platform operational.
  • Advanced Features: For more advanced functionalities such as margin trading, staking, and lending, the cost could range from $100,000 to $150,000. These features not only enhance user experience but also provide additional revenue streams and trading options, making your exchange more competitive and user-friendly.
  • Security & Compliance: Ensuring that your platform meets the highest security standards and complies with regulatory requirements could add another $30,000 to $50,000 to your budget. This includes implementing robust security measures like multi-factor authentication, encryption, and regular security audits, as well as adhering to financial regulations and obtaining necessary certifications.
  • Custom Development: If you need extensive customizations, the cost could go beyond $200,000, depending on the complexity and scale of the changes. Custom development might include unique interface designs, proprietary algorithmic trading systems, or integration with other financial services. The more tailored your platform is to specific user needs, the higher the investment required to ensure it meets all specifications and performs reliably.

Suggested: How Much Does it Cost to Create An App

How can iTechnolabs help you to build a Crypto Exchange Platform Like Binance?

iTechnolabs is a leading cryptocurrency exchange development company, offering end-to-end solutions for building secure and scalable trading platforms like Binance. With years of experience in the industry and a team of skilled developers, we can help you create a robust and feature-rich exchange that meets your specific business requirements.

Our services include:

  • Consultation & Planning: Our team works closely with you to understand your business goals, target audience, and budget to develop a detailed project plan that aligns with your vision.
  • Platform Development: We use cutting-edge technologies to develop a scalable and customizable exchange platform with essential features like order matching, charting tools, and real-time market data.
  • Security: We incorporate multiple layers of security measures to ensure that your platform is protected against cyber threats and meets regulatory compliance standards.
  • API Integration: Our experts can integrate APIs from various exchanges, payment gateways, and liquidity providers for a seamless trading experience for your users.
  • Mobile App Development: In addition to web-based platforms, we also offer mobile app development services to cater to the growing demand for on-the-go trading.
  • Support & Maintenance: We provide ongoing support and maintenance services to ensure that your exchange platform continues to function smoothly and efficiently.

Are you planning to create a Crypto Exchange platform like Binance?

Contact us!

Opting for iTechnolabs to build your crypto exchange platform like Binance comes with a multitude of benefits. Our team of experts leverages cutting-edge technology and industry best practices to ensure your platform is secure, scalable, and user-friendly. Additionally, we offer ongoing support and updates to help you stay ahead in the fast-evolving cryptocurrency market.  Here’s why:

  • Expertise and Experience: With years of experience in the cryptocurrency industry, iTechnolabs brings a wealth of knowledge and expertise to the table. Our developers are well-versed in the latest technologies and regulations, ensuring that your platform is built using best practices.
  • Customization and Scalability: We understand that every business has unique requirements. That’s why we offer highly customizable solutions that can be tailored to meet your specific needs. Additionally, our platforms are designed to scale efficiently, allowing for future growth and expansion.
  • Comprehensive Security: Security is a paramount concern in the crypto space. Our multi-layered security measures, including encryption, two-factor authentication, and anti-DDoS protection, ensure that your platform is shielded against cyber threats and adheres to regulatory compliance standards.
  • User-Friendly Interface: A seamless and intuitive user experience is crucial for the success of any trading platform. Our design team focuses on creating user-friendly interfaces that cater to both novice and experienced traders, making it easy for them to navigate and perform transactions.
  • Integrated Solutions: Our end-to-end solutions cover everything from API integrations to mobile app development. This means you get a holistic product that includes real-time market data, payment gateway integration, and a dedicated mobile app for trading on the go.
  • Ongoing Support and Maintenance: Launching your platform is just the beginning. We provide continuous support and maintenance services to ensure your platform remains up-to-date and functions smoothly. Our dedicated support team is always on hand to resolve any issues that may arise.

Important: Blockchain Development Process – A Complete Guide


These are just a few of the best practices we follow when developing cryptocurrency trading platforms. By incorporating these elements into your platform, you can ensure a seamless and secure user experience that will attract and retain traders. With our expertise and commitment to excellence, we can help you build a successful crypto trading platform that meets all industry standards and regulations.

Looking for Free Software Consultation?
Fill out our form and a software expert will contact you within 24hrs
Need Help With Development?
Need Help with Software Development?
Need Help With Development?

We trust that you find this information valuable!

Schedule a call with our skilled professionals in software or app development